При составлении тематической карты плотности населения вы столкнулись с искажением отображения густонаселённых прибрежных районов из‑за выбранной картографической проекции; какие критерии выбора проекции и методы переработки данных вы примените, чтобы минимизировать искажения и обеспечить корректную интерпретацию?
Кратко — главная цель при картировании плотности: сохранить корректность площади (плотность = население / площадь), поэтому выбирать и готовить данные так, чтобы минимизировать искажения площади в зоне интереса. Дальше — конкретные критерии и практические шаги. Критерии выбора проекции - Сохранение площади: для карт плотности предпочтительны равноплощадные (equal‑area) проекции, т.к. они сохраняют отношение площади и не искажают плотность визуально. - Масштаб и охват: глобальная карта → глобальная равноплощадная (цил.-равнопл.), региональная/континентальная → Albers Equal‑Area Conic, локальная/округлая зона вдоль побережья → Lambert Azimuthal Equal‑Area, кастомный локальный equal‑area. - Ориентация и форма бассейна: для длинных узких побережий подберите проекцию, чьи стандартные параллели/центры проходят по оси класса плотности, чтобы минимизировать линейные искажения вдоль полосы. - Согласованность данных/системы координат (datum): используйте единый геодезический datum (например, WGS84 или локальный) и документируйте CRS. - Практичность: поддержка в GIS/библиотеках (PROJ, GDAL), возможность настройки стандартных параллелей/точки центра. Рекомендации по конкретным проекциям (примерно) - Регион/страна в средних широтах (широкая область): Albers Equal‑Area Conic (подберите стандартные параллели). - Локальная прибрежная зона (радиально/круговая зона): Lambert Azimuthal Equal‑Area, центрированная на регион. - Глобальная карта: Cylindrical Equal‑Area (Behrmann, Mollweide — псевдоравноплощадные для визуализации). (Для задач вариативности можно настраивать стандартные параллели/центр.) Подготовка и переработка данных 1. Вычисляйте плотность по истинной площади на поверхности (эллипсоиде/сфере), а не по проецированной площади. Базовая формула: ρ=PA\rho=\frac{P}{A}ρ=AP, где PPP — население, AAA — площадь (км2^22). 2. Способ вычисления площади: - Для векторных полигонов: используйте геодезические функции (GeographicLib, pyproj.Geod.polygon_area_perimeter или аналог в GIS), чтобы получить геодезическую площадь на эллипсоиде. - Альтернатива: пере-проекция в равноплощадную CRS, затем вычисление планарной площади — при условии, что выбранная CRS минимизирует искажения в зоне. 3. Аггрегация на равноплощадные ячейки: - Используйте равноплощадную сетку (квадраты/шестиугольники, DGGS, HEALPix, H3) и агрегацию в ячейки фиксированной площади, чтобы устранить MAUP (modifiable areal unit problem). 4. Уточнение распределения внутри полигонов: - Dasymetric redistribution: перераспределяйте население внутри административных границ с использованием данных землепользования, ночных огней, построек, зданий, чтобы избежать фиктивной концентрации вдоль береговой линии. - Построечные/спутниковые данные для урбанистических районов дадут более точную локализацию плотности. 5. Маскирование воды и негустонаселённых территорий: - Исключите водные площади и нерелевантные зоны из знаменателя площади (используйте land mask). Для побережья важно считать лишь обитаемую сушу. 6. Работа с растровыми данными: - Растеризуйте население в равноплощадную сетку сразу в равноплощадной CRS или сначала в географической, затем ре-проектируйте в equal‑area с качественным алгоритмом ресемплинга (суммирование, а не среднее), чтобы не терять суммарного населения. 7. Буферизация и границы: - Для побережий уменьшите погрешности границ путем буферов/усреднения при агрегации; при стыке с морем используйте корректное обрезание по береговой линии. Оценка и контроль искажений - Оценивайте фактор искажения площади: D=AprojAtrueD=\frac{A_{proj}}{A_{true}}D=AtrueAproj. Для корректной equal‑area проекции должно быть D≈1D\approx 1D≈1 по всей зоне интереса. Ошибку можно представить как ε=Aproj−AtrueAtrue\varepsilon=\frac{A_{proj}-A_{true}}{A_{true}}ε=AtrueAproj−Atrue. - Используйте индикатор Тиссо (Tissot’s indicatrix) или карты масштабных факторов (меридиональный и параллельный масштабы h,kh,kh,k, где фактор площади s=h⋅ks=h\cdot ks=h⋅k) для визуализации, где искажения значительны. - Делайте сравнительные тестовые карты (несколько проекций/параметров), смотрите на распределение плотности и относительную ошибку. Визуализация и интерпретация - Чётко указывайте CRS/проекцию и метод расчёта площади в легенде/метаданных. - Подпись единиц плотности: чел/км2^22 (обязательно указывайте, считаются ли водные площади). - Используйте equal‑area для финальной визуализации плотности; при необходимости добавьте inset с картой искажений. - Для побережий используйте прозрачность, контуры урбанистических границ и dasymetric слои, чтобы не вводить в заблуждение (визуальный «плотностный бугр» у линии берега). - Подбирайте шкалу классификации аккуратно (например, квантиль/натуральные разрывы), и указывайте, что классификация влияет на восприятие концентраций. Краткий рабочий порядок (практический чек‑лист) 1. Выбрать равноплощадную CRS, оптимизированную под зону интереса (Albers / Lambert Azimuthal / кастом). 2. Привести все слои к единому datum/CRS. 3. Исключить воду/необитаемые участки; при необходимости применить dasymetric пересчет. 4. Вычислить площади геодезически или в equal‑area CRS и вычислить ρ=PA\rho=\frac{P}{A}ρ=AP. 5. Аггрегировать в равноплощадную сетку (если нужно), проверить суммарное население и ошибки. 6. Оценить искажения (D, Tissot), при необходимости перенастроить проекцию. 7. Визуализировать с явной легендой, метаданными и индикацией проекции. Эти шаги минимизируют искажения при картировании прибрежных густонаселённых районов и обеспечат корректную интерпретацию плотности.
Критерии выбора проекции
- Сохранение площади: для карт плотности предпочтительны равноплощадные (equal‑area) проекции, т.к. они сохраняют отношение площади и не искажают плотность визуально.
- Масштаб и охват: глобальная карта → глобальная равноплощадная (цил.-равнопл.), региональная/континентальная → Albers Equal‑Area Conic, локальная/округлая зона вдоль побережья → Lambert Azimuthal Equal‑Area, кастомный локальный equal‑area.
- Ориентация и форма бассейна: для длинных узких побережий подберите проекцию, чьи стандартные параллели/центры проходят по оси класса плотности, чтобы минимизировать линейные искажения вдоль полосы.
- Согласованность данных/системы координат (datum): используйте единый геодезический datum (например, WGS84 или локальный) и документируйте CRS.
- Практичность: поддержка в GIS/библиотеках (PROJ, GDAL), возможность настройки стандартных параллелей/точки центра.
Рекомендации по конкретным проекциям (примерно)
- Регион/страна в средних широтах (широкая область): Albers Equal‑Area Conic (подберите стандартные параллели).
- Локальная прибрежная зона (радиально/круговая зона): Lambert Azimuthal Equal‑Area, центрированная на регион.
- Глобальная карта: Cylindrical Equal‑Area (Behrmann, Mollweide — псевдоравноплощадные для визуализации).
(Для задач вариативности можно настраивать стандартные параллели/центр.)
Подготовка и переработка данных
1. Вычисляйте плотность по истинной площади на поверхности (эллипсоиде/сфере), а не по проецированной площади. Базовая формула: ρ=PA\rho=\frac{P}{A}ρ=AP , где PPP — население, AAA — площадь (км2^22).
2. Способ вычисления площади:
- Для векторных полигонов: используйте геодезические функции (GeographicLib, pyproj.Geod.polygon_area_perimeter или аналог в GIS), чтобы получить геодезическую площадь на эллипсоиде.
- Альтернатива: пере-проекция в равноплощадную CRS, затем вычисление планарной площади — при условии, что выбранная CRS минимизирует искажения в зоне.
3. Аггрегация на равноплощадные ячейки:
- Используйте равноплощадную сетку (квадраты/шестиугольники, DGGS, HEALPix, H3) и агрегацию в ячейки фиксированной площади, чтобы устранить MAUP (modifiable areal unit problem).
4. Уточнение распределения внутри полигонов:
- Dasymetric redistribution: перераспределяйте население внутри административных границ с использованием данных землепользования, ночных огней, построек, зданий, чтобы избежать фиктивной концентрации вдоль береговой линии.
- Построечные/спутниковые данные для урбанистических районов дадут более точную локализацию плотности.
5. Маскирование воды и негустонаселённых территорий:
- Исключите водные площади и нерелевантные зоны из знаменателя площади (используйте land mask). Для побережья важно считать лишь обитаемую сушу.
6. Работа с растровыми данными:
- Растеризуйте население в равноплощадную сетку сразу в равноплощадной CRS или сначала в географической, затем ре-проектируйте в equal‑area с качественным алгоритмом ресемплинга (суммирование, а не среднее), чтобы не терять суммарного населения.
7. Буферизация и границы:
- Для побережий уменьшите погрешности границ путем буферов/усреднения при агрегации; при стыке с морем используйте корректное обрезание по береговой линии.
Оценка и контроль искажений
- Оценивайте фактор искажения площади: D=AprojAtrueD=\frac{A_{proj}}{A_{true}}D=Atrue Aproj . Для корректной equal‑area проекции должно быть D≈1D\approx 1D≈1 по всей зоне интереса. Ошибку можно представить как ε=Aproj−AtrueAtrue\varepsilon=\frac{A_{proj}-A_{true}}{A_{true}}ε=Atrue Aproj −Atrue .
- Используйте индикатор Тиссо (Tissot’s indicatrix) или карты масштабных факторов (меридиональный и параллельный масштабы h,kh,kh,k, где фактор площади s=h⋅ks=h\cdot ks=h⋅k) для визуализации, где искажения значительны.
- Делайте сравнительные тестовые карты (несколько проекций/параметров), смотрите на распределение плотности и относительную ошибку.
Визуализация и интерпретация
- Чётко указывайте CRS/проекцию и метод расчёта площади в легенде/метаданных.
- Подпись единиц плотности: чел/км2^22 (обязательно указывайте, считаются ли водные площади).
- Используйте equal‑area для финальной визуализации плотности; при необходимости добавьте inset с картой искажений.
- Для побережий используйте прозрачность, контуры урбанистических границ и dasymetric слои, чтобы не вводить в заблуждение (визуальный «плотностный бугр» у линии берега).
- Подбирайте шкалу классификации аккуратно (например, квантиль/натуральные разрывы), и указывайте, что классификация влияет на восприятие концентраций.
Краткий рабочий порядок (практический чек‑лист)
1. Выбрать равноплощадную CRS, оптимизированную под зону интереса (Albers / Lambert Azimuthal / кастом).
2. Привести все слои к единому datum/CRS.
3. Исключить воду/необитаемые участки; при необходимости применить dasymetric пересчет.
4. Вычислить площади геодезически или в equal‑area CRS и вычислить ρ=PA\rho=\frac{P}{A}ρ=AP .
5. Аггрегировать в равноплощадную сетку (если нужно), проверить суммарное население и ошибки.
6. Оценить искажения (D, Tissot), при необходимости перенастроить проекцию.
7. Визуализировать с явной легендой, метаданными и индикацией проекции.
Эти шаги минимизируют искажения при картировании прибрежных густонаселённых районов и обеспечат корректную интерпретацию плотности.